Why do we need payment solution apps?
There are many advantages to using online payment apps. We have listed some of them for you below.
With the mobile payment method, businesses can do better cash flow management. Stakeholders can track every transaction made thanks to fintech applications.
With mobile payment solutions, small-budget businesses need less staff for transaction follow-up.
Thanks to the growing popularity of mobile devices, shopping has become available online. Mobile payment solutions are required to buy and sell from mobile devices.

What are the key features of a successful Fintech mobile app?
As with every application, the popularity of the platforms is directly proportional to the features they offer to their customers. According to the research we have done, we have listed the features of a good Fintech application for you below.
Easy to Use and Understand
With Fintech applications, users can easily manage their financial transactions. Ease of use is one of the most important aspects of a Fintech application
Fintech mobile apps should have an interface that organizes financial data, displays transaction history, and provides simple analytical tools. It should also include real-time data tables that help users increase their income.
Protection and Security of Sensitive Data
Since Fintech applications contain all kinds of financial data of their users, the privacy and security of user data is the most important issue that should be given priority. Technology isn't just developing well and beneficially. Increasing cyberattacks have also made users less secure while using Fintech applications. For this reason, companies should offer full cybersecurity to their customers while developing Fintech applications.
Classical security features in applications are as follows;
Profile crash after the third unsuccessful login attempt.
Re-entering the password while updating the information in the profile
Displaying only the last three digits of Credit / Debit Cards.
Integration of voice and face recognition.
Integration of fingerprint authentication in addition to 2-Factor Authentication.

How to create a Fintech Mobile App
A lot of technical knowledge is required to develop a fintech application. That's why you need an experienced team to develop applications. Now we will briefly summarize the steps of application development.
Step # 1: After doing your research, define the MVP scope by planning for the appearance and features of the app
Step # 2: You need to hire a developer team to develop the app.
Step # 3: You must choose the software language you will use. You need to use different software languages for IOS and Android, which will increase the cost of development. Or you can use Cross-platform application development, which can reduce your cost by 60%.
Step # 4: Design the user interface in eye-catching colors and ease of use.
Step # 5: Try it with specific customers by launching a Beta app to test the app
Step # 6: Update your app from time to time by following the innovations in the industry.
